Trang 1Features and Benefits Description Where to Find Improved! Integrated print
experience
Adjust print settings while viewing a large print preview of your publication—no need to switch back and forth between multiple screens to see the impact of your changes
View page boundaries, page numbers, sheet rulers and other key print information You can also use the new backlight feature to see
―through‖ the paper to preview the other side
of your publication, so that your page ―flips‖
exactly as you want it
Click the File tab to open Backstage view and then click Print
Set your multipage publication to print two-sided to enable the backlight slider control at the upper-right of the preview pane
Improved! Commercial and
digital printing support
Documents designed for printing in larger quantities at higher-quality often have different color needs Publisher 2010 supports
a variety of color models including four-color process and spot color printing, CMYK composite postscript, save as PDF, support for Pantone® colors - PMS and the NEW! Pantone GOE color system
Click the File tab to open Backstage view
Click Info and then click Commercial Print Settings to select a color model as well as to manage embedded fonts and other settings
When you are ready to send your presentation to print, in Backstage view, click Save & Send and then click Save for a Commercial Printer
Trang 2Features and Benefits Description Where to Find Improved! Create PDF or XPS Quickly create the perfect PDF or XPS version
of your publication Expanded output options—including the ability to password-protect PDF files—make it easy to share for commercial or desktop printing, e-mail, or viewing online
Click the File tab to open Backstage view Click Save & Send and then click Create PDF/XPS Document
Note: You can also save a copy of your publication
in any of several image formats, such as JPEG, for easy printing and sharing No add-ins are required
To access available image formats, in Backstage view, on the Save & Send tab, click Change File
Type

Trang 4SharePoint Workspace 201034 expands the boundaries of collaboration by allowing fast, anytime, anywhere access to your SharePoint team sites Synchronize Microsoft SharePoint Server 2010 content with SharePoint Workspace so you can access, view, and edit files from your computer Working across teams is also much easier when you can co-author documents simultaneously with other people
in SharePoint Workspace and automatically synchronize changes to SharePoint Server 2010 without additional steps SharePoint Workspace 2010 ushers in an entirely new way of working with your SharePoint team sites
New! Direct folder access Access your SharePoint and Groove
workspaces directly from Windows folders
On the Windows taskbar, click the Windows Start button and then click your name (profile)
Double-click to open the Workspaces
folder From here you can navigate to your spaces where you can open, add or remove files as you need

Trang 8Features and Benefits Description Where to Find
Business Connectivity Services
SharePoint Business Connectivity Services (BCS) enables connections to external data sources—including read and write access to line-of-business applications When combined with SharePoint Workspace’s offline capability, you can review your external data inside SharePoint Workspace and even make changes
to the data SharePoint Workspace synchronizes your changes directly to the external data source
Open a SharePoint Server 2010 site in your browser
Click Site Actions and then click Sync to Computer In the SharePoint
Workspace 2010 dialog box, click
Configure to select a subset of content
Select any SharePoint 2010 list that is enabled for Business Connectivity Services
After sync completes, that data will display in SharePoint Workspace as well

Mobile 2010
Take your SharePoint files offline on your phone with Microsoft SharePoint® Workspace Mobile 2010, a new application in Office Mobile 2010 Browse document libraries and other lists right from your Windows phone
Open documents directly from Microsoft SharePoint Server 2010 for viewing or editing,
in Word Mobile 2010, Excel Mobile 2010, and PowerPoint Mobile 2010, and save them directly back to the server Easily sync documents on your smartphone with a single touch—when a document is modified on the server, the copy on your Windows phone will
be synced automatically
Office Mobile 2010 is not included in Office 2010 applications, suites, or Web Apps It will be released on Windows phones (Windows Mobile 6.5 or above)
by the general availability of Microsoft Office 2010
